Ecuador Flag Flag Information three horizontal bands of yellow (top, double width), blue, and red with the coat of arms superimposed at the center of the flag the flag retains the three main colors of the banner of Gran Colombia, the South American republic that broke up in 1830 the yellow color represents sunshine, grain, and mineral wealth, blue the sky, sea, and rivers, and red the blood of patriots spilled in the struggle for freedom and justice note: similar to the flag of Colombia, which is shorter and does not bear a coat of arms
